Output 42567923a5aaf06afeed0150e605249c947d2652708d03deb9a87b37b1517c2c:0

value
2689991
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e4ac80e7fd8c8ec48837621d61b04122c5543b4 OP_EQUALVERIFY OP_CHECKSIG
address
1QBaDdhCTC2k9WWFhCXCJvYHpVSqLSRxaJ
transaction
42567923a5aaf06afeed0150e605249c947d2652708d03deb9a87b37b1517c2c
confirmations
371440
spent
true